Step-by-Step Guide to Delete or Deactivate Your Ingress Account

  1. Log in to your Ingress account.
  2. Go to Account Settings or Privacy within Ingress.
  3. Find the option for Delete Account, Close Account, or Deactivate.
  4. Follow verification prompts, including password re-entry or email confirmation for Ingress.
  5. Download or export important data, messages, and files from Ingress.
  6. Confirm your deletion or deactivation decision.
  7. Check your email or Ingress notifications for confirmation.

Additional Considerations Before Deleting Your Ingress Account

  • Permanent deletion is irreversible and may result in loss of your Ingress data.
  • Back up essential files, contacts, messages, and other data from Ingress.
  • Disconnect linked apps, subscriptions, or services connected to Ingress.
  • Check recovery or grace periods for Ingress if available.
  • Review Ingress's privacy policies for retained data after deletion.
